Abstract
Disclosed is a method for determining internal uniaxial stress of steel members based on transverse wave phase spectrum, including: manufacturing a replicated steel member of an in-service steel structure member, where the replicated steel member and the in-service steel structure member are the same in material and thickness; loading a test on the replicated steel member to obtain two stress-spectral parameters; performing ultrasonic determination on the in-service steel structure member using an ultrasonic determination device; and collecting transverse wave signals using a signal acquisition system; processing the collected transverse wave signals through an information processing device to obtain a derived curve of the phase spectrum; capturing a first response frequency of the phase spectrum from the phase spectrum derived curve; and obtaining a uniaxial stress of the in-service steel structure member according to the stress-spectral parameters.
